the healthiest populations around the world enjoy daily but wait is every drink good for your healthy life if you want to live a fit life then watch the complete video to find out some drinks that you must avoid now let's get started one green tea green tea is celebr ated globally for its health benefits kakin the most crucial antioxidants in green tea include egcg which has profound Health implications these compounds are powerful at reducing inflammation and fighting cancer they help neutralize harmful free radicals which are unstable molecules that may damage cells and lead to chronic
diseases including heart diseases and cancer bgcg in particular is known for its ability to enhance heart health by improving blood vessel function and lowering cholesterol and blood pressure caffeine another important component while less potent in green tea than in other caffeinated beverages like coffee still plays a vital role it stimulates the nervous system making you feel more alert and focused and may improve brain function this includes better memory reaction times and general cognitive function apart from that lanine and amino acid unique to tea works synergistically with caffeine it promotes relaxation and may help reduce stress
without causing drowsiness this combination impacts brain function positively providing a stable and extended release of energy without the Jitters associated with high caffeine intake moreover a review of 14 studies found that people who drank High concentration green tea for 12 weeks lost an average of 200 to 3500 G of body weight more than those who did not drink green tea for daily consumption drinking about 3 to four cups of green tea is recommended to maximize its health benefits without overdoing it for instance excessive green tea intake may lead to caffeine related side effects such as
nervousness insomnia or an upset stomach particularly if consumed on an empty stomach two ginger tea ginger tea is a popular herbal beverage that offers a variety of health benefits due to its potent Active Components primarily gingerol it is highly effective at reducing inflammation this is particularly beneficial for managing conditions like arthritis and other inflammatory diseases shal another component of Ginger contributes similar anti-inflammatory and antioxidant benefits as gingerol but it is especially effective in relieving nausea and vomiting this makes ginger tea a common recommendation for those suffering from upset stomachs morning sickness or the side effects
of chemotherapy one study in 92 women found that Ginger was more effective than a standard drug at preventing postoperative nausea and vomiting caused by general anesthesia it indicates that drinking ginger tea may also offer similar benefits for daily consumption sipping 1 to two cups of ginger tea is generally considered safe for most people and enough to reap its health benefits however it's important to be aware of the potential downsides of excessive consumption high doses of Ginger may cause mild heartburn diarrhea and stomach discomfort three turmeric milk turmeric milk often referred to as golden milk is
a traditional Indian drink that combines turmeric powder with warm milk and sometimes other spices like black pepper and cinnamon this drink has gained popularity worldwide for its health benefits primarily due to the active compound in turmeric called kirkin kirkin is a potent anti-inflammatory and antioxidant agent which forms the basis for most of the health benefits associated with turmeric milk furthermore turmeric milk May boost brain health the ability of kirkin to cross the bloodb brain barrier means it may directly enter the brain and benefit the cells there potentially lowering the risk of neurodegenerative conditions like Alzheimer's
disease moreover depression may also be linked to low levels of brain derived neurotrophic Factor as kirkin appears to boost levels of this Factor turmeric milk may have the potential to reduce symptoms of depression the ideal daily dose of turmeric milk involves consuming about a teaspoon of turmeric powder mixed in a glass of milk which is generally safe and sufficient to achieve health benefits additionally kirkin may act as a blood thinner which might enhance the risk of bleeding especially in individuals taking blood thinning medications or who have bleeding disorders therefore it is always advisable to start
with small doses and consult healthc care providers if you are under medication or have existing health concerns four kombucha kombucha a fermented tea that has been consumed for thousands of years is known for its unique combination of vinegar B vitamins enzymes probiotics and a high concentration of acid acidic gluconic and lactic which promote Health in various ways one of the key elements of Kombucha is the wealth of probiotics it contains due to the fermentation process these probiotics are beneficial bacteria that help maintain a healthy balance in the gut a healthy gut Flora is essential for
Effective digestion but it also plays a crucial role in the immune system and may help reduce the risk of infections from harmful bacteria a Additionally the acids formed during the fermentation process May detoxify the body by binding two and neutralizing waste products and toxins in the gut this detoxification supports liver function and may improve overall bodily detoxification aiding and reducing the workload on the liver and promoting overall health animal Studies have found that drinking kombucha regularly reduces liver toxicity caused by toxic chemicals while no human studies exist on this topic it seems like a promising
benefit for people with liver disease for daily consumption 1 to two cups of Kombucha is generally considered safe and effective however because it contains a small amount of alcohol as a byproduct of the fermentation process it is important for pregnant women nursing mothers and anyone with alcohol sensitivity to avoid or limit their intake five beet juice beet juice derived from the root of the Beet plant has garnered attention for its high content of nutrients including nitrates after consumption the body transforms nitrates into nitric oxide a molecule that is essential for controlling blood pressure and flow
nitric oxide helps widen and relax blood vessels which improves circulation and lowers blood pressure uh 2022 metaanalysis notes that nitrate from beetroot juice lowers systolic blood pressure in adults with hypertension ban another important compound found in beets has a role in reducing inflammation and protecting cells from environmental stress it also helps improve liver function by aiding and detoxification processes and protecting liver cells from toxins additionally betain contributes to improved athletic performance by enhancing muscle endurance and reducing fatigue the recommended daily dose of beet juice for health benefits is about 1 cup per day however due
to its high nitrate content excessive consumption may increase the risk of kidney stones six pomegranate juice pomegranate juice contains high levels of antioxidants including Punic collagens and vitamin C these compounds are key players in the health benefits associated with pomegranate juice Punic colagens are extremely potent antioxidants found in the Ju juice and peel of pomegranates they help reduce oxidative stress in the body by neutralizing free radicals unstable molecules that may damage cells and lead to chronic diseases such as cancer and heart disease the antioxidant power of Punic collagens is shown to be higher than that
of many other fruit juices making pomegranate juice particularly effective in guarding against oxidative damage apart from that in a study pomegranate extract was found to inhibit the mechanism associated with stone formation in people with recurrent kidney stones vitamin C a well-known immune system booster is also abundant in pomegranate juice it supports the immune system AIDS in the repair and maintenance of tissues and enhances the body's ability to synthesize collagen which is vital for skin and joint health the recommended daily intake of pomegranate juice for health benefits is about 8 O furthermore its high acid content
may be Troublesome for people with gastrosoph agial reflux disease or similar conditions as it may exacerbate symptoms of heartburn and discomfort seven red wine red wine is often cited for its health benefits which are attributed to key compounds like resut trol flavonoids and tannins resor troll is perhaps the most celebrated compound in red wine it's a type of polyphenol found in the skins of red grapes and is known for its antioxidant and anti-inflammatory properties antioxidants help protect the body cells from damage caused by oxidative stress in free radicals which are implicated in various diseases including
heart disease and cancer Resveratrol may also improve the health of blood vessels by increasing nitric oxide production which helps vessels relax and decreases the likelihood of blood clot for this may lead to lower blood pressure and a reduced risk of heart disease in fact one study also showed that consuming 2 to three glasses of decoled red wine per day May lower blood pressure flavonoids in red wine another group of antioxidants contribute to heart health by reducing bad cholesterol LDL levels and increasing good cholesterol HDL levels they also play a role in reducing inflammation throughout the
body tannins which contribute to the bitter taste in red wine have been shown to possess antioxidant properties as well tannins help fight against heart disease by improving the overall structure and function of blood vessels for men moderate consumption is defined as up to two glasses or 5 O each per day and for women it's up to one glass per day furthermore individuals with certain health conditions such as those with a history of alcoholism liver disease or pancreatitis should avoid alcohol altogether eight coconut water electrolytes are crucial for maintaining fluid balance in the body regulating heart
rhythm muscle function and nerve signaling coconut water is particularly high in pottassium which helps balance sodium levels in the body aiding in controlling blood pressure and reducing the risk of cardiovascular diseases potassium also supports kidney function by promoting the excretion of sodium through urine this effect may help prevent kidney stones and maintain healthy blood pressure levels a recent study from 2021 involving rats with diabetes also found that coconut water reduced blood glucose it suggests that there may be a possibility of managing high blood sugar levels by just consuming coconut water magnesium and coconut water enhances
its health benefits by aiding in muscle relaxation and regulating muscle and nerve functions it's also vital for energy production and supports the synthesis of DNA calcium another important mineral found in coconut water is essential for bone health it helps in building and maintaining strong bones and teeth and it also plays a role in heart and muscle action a reasonable daily intake of coconut water is 1 to 2 cups or 8 to 16 o excessive consumption of coconut water may lead to hyper calmia a condition characterized by too much potassium in the blood which may affect
heart health nine hibiscus tea the primary element that makes habiscus tea a healthy choice is its Rich anthocyanin content anthocyanins are a type of flavonoid with potent antioxidant properties they help the body combat oxidative stress which is linked to to many chronic diseases including heart disease and cancer by neutralizing free radicals anthocyanins help protect cells from damage and reduce inflammation throughout the body a study in 19 people who were overweight found that taking hibiscus extract for 12 weeks improved liver atosis this condition is characterized by the accumulation of fat in the liver which may lead
to liver failure vitamin C another key antioxidant inhibit discus tea enhances its health benefits it boosts the immune system AIDS in the repair of tissues and promotes the absorption of iron a vital mineral for oxygen transport and energy production vitamin C also supports skin Health by contributing to collagen formation which is essential for skin elasticity and wound healing for those looking to incorporate habiscus tea into their daily routine a reasonable amount is about 2 to three cups per day however it has a naturally occurring compound that may affect estrogen levels making it potentially unsuitable for
pregnant women or those with hormone sensitive conditions 10 matcha matcha a finely ground powder is made from specially grown and processed green tea leaves the key elements contributing to its health benefits include high concentrations of kakens particular ularly egcg it's celebrated for its potent antioxidant properties that help reduce cellular damage caused by free radicals this reduction in oxidative stress is vital for preventing chronic diseases such as heart disease type 2 diabetes and certain cancers egcg is also known to boost metabolism and Aid in weight loss by increasing fat oxidation matcha contains a balanced amount of
caffeine which provides a more sustained release of energy this is partly due to the presence of alanine an amino acid that promotes relaxation without drowsiness lanine also enhances mood and improves cognitive function by increasing the activity of the neurotransmitter Gaba which has anti-anxiety effects the combination of caffeine and lanine in matcha leads to improved concentration and Clarity of mind without the nervous energy often associated iated with coffee one study found that women who consumed 3 gram of matcha per day experience greater fat burning during exercise compared to women who did not drink matcha for daily
consumption about 1 to two teaspoons of matcha powder or one to two cups of prepared matcha tea is considered a good amount to reap its health benefits while avoiding potential side effects additionally because matcha involves consuming the whole Tea Leaf in powdered form it may contain more lead and other heavy metals than other teas where leaves are steeped and then removed this is particularly a concern if the tea plants are grown in polluted environments avoiding certain drinks may be just as crucial for maintaining good health as choosing the right ones remember this list of beverages
to generally avoid or consume in moderation let's talk about a few drinks you should avoid if you want to stay healthy one sugary soft drinks these beverages are high in added sugars and offer little nutritional value regular consumption may lead to weight gain and an increased risk of type 2 diabetes heart disease and other chronic conditions the high sugar content also contributes to tooth decay and may lead to spikes and crashes in blood sugar levels two energy drinks energy drinks are loaded with caffeine and other stimulants like Gana and talene which may increase heart rate
and blood pressure potentially leading to heart rhythm disturbances and other cardiovascular problems they often contain high levels of sugar and artificial additives as well three premixed alcoholic beverages these often contain a lot of sugar calories and sometimes caffeine the combination of sugar and alcohol may be particularly harmful as it not only adds empty calories but also may lead to quicker intoxication and more severe hangovers while masking the amount of alcohol being consumed four diet sodas while they are low in calories diet sodas contain artificial sweeteners like aspartame sucrose and sakuran which some studies suggest May
contribute to weight gain and Cravings by altering taste perceptions and hormone levels in the body the long-term effects of regular consumption of artificial sweeteners are still unclear but may include an altered gut microbiota and an increased risk of certain diseases five fruit juices even 100% fruit juice may be a problem in consumed in excess fruit juices are very high in sugar and calories and lack the fiber of whole fruit which helps slow down sugar absorption and increases satiety drinking large amounts of fruit juice may lead to increased blood sugar levels weight gain and an increased
risk of type 2 diabetes six cream-based lick Yos these are high in sugar and saturated fat regular consumption may lead to weight gain and an increase in LDL cholesterol which is linked to cardiovascular disease they also contribute to excessive calorie intake each of these beverages offers unique benefits contributing to hydration nutrient intake and disease prevention integrating them into your daily diet may help maintain and improve your overall health mirroring some of the healthiest people globally remember the key is moderation and understanding what each drink may offer in terms of health benefits now that we have
